Output 8c332a19a7537cdde8663f091fcaad60ed789a6c0a6ee747703cc96ebff55727:4

value
26906558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 889e8492f9e383ee7792eb6ff9464a780497620e OP_EQUAL
address
3E9PieVXAyaX4KRGQZYxkik7WmiPWGXY5W
transaction
8c332a19a7537cdde8663f091fcaad60ed789a6c0a6ee747703cc96ebff55727
spent
true